Ingredients

English Muffin:
Made using enriched wheat flour (wheat and malted barley flour, niacin, reduced iron, thiamine mononitrate, riboflavin, folic acid) combined with water and cake flour (bleached wheat flour). Contains yeast and sugars (sugar and honey), along with a sponge mixture made from wheat sourdough (water and fermented wheat flour), sponge extract (water and fermented wheat flour), salt, inactivated yeast, potassium citrate, enzymes, and xanthan gum. Includes degermed yellow corn flour and cornmeal, soybean oil, wheat gluten, honey, calcium propionate for preservation, distilled monoglycerides, wheat flour, ascorbic acid, and fumaric acid.
Allergens: Contains wheat and barley. Toasted on shared equipment with products that contain milk, soy, and wheat.

Egg:
Prepared from fresh eggs seasoned with a touch of salt.
Allergens: Contains egg.

Applewood Smoked Bacon:
Made from pork cured with water, salt, and sugar. Enhanced with smoke flavor and preserved using sodium phosphate, sodium erythorbate, and sodium nitrite. Naturally smoked for a rich, savory taste.

Processed Cheese Slice:
Composed of cheese (milk, modified milk ingredients, and cream) combined with bacterial culture, salt, calcium chloride, and annatto for color. Includes rennet or microbial enzyme, lipase, and modified milk ingredients blended with water. Features sodium citrate or sodium phosphate, glucose, skim milk powder, salt, acetic acid, and sorbic acid. Soy lecithin and soybean oil help separate slices, while carboxymethylcellulose, citric acid, and colorants (annatto or β-apo-8’-carotenal) preserve texture and hue.
Allergens: Contains milk and soy.

Biscuit Dressing:
Prepared from canola oil and hydrogenated cottonseed oil, seasoned with salt and natural flavors. Contains soy lecithin and beta carotene for color and smooth texture.
Allergens: Contains soy and milk.

All ingredients sourced from Wendy’s official listings.

Calories & Nutrition Insights

The Wendy’s Bacon Egg & Cheese English Muffin contains 380 calories, making it a moderate choice for breakfast or lunch. It offers a balanced combination of protein, fats, and carbohydrates, providing enough energy without being too heavy. With 17 grams of protein, it’s a solid option to fuel your day, especially if you’re looking to stay satisfied for a few hours.

At 20 grams of fat, including 6 grams of saturated fat, this muffin is on the higher end in terms of fat content, so it’s best to enjoy in moderation if you’re watching your fat intake. The 820 milligrams of sodium is also something to be mindful of, especially if you’re trying to reduce sodium in your diet.

With 31 grams of carbohydrates and 1 gram of fiber, this sandwich isn’t particularly high in fiber, so pairing it with a fiber-rich side like a salad or fruit could boost its nutritional value. The 4 grams of sugar are relatively low, which is a plus if you’re trying to avoid added sugars.

In summary, this sandwich is a moderate choice if you’re seeking a meal with protein and a bit of indulgence from fats. It’s a good option if you’re aiming for a balanced, filling breakfast but might not be the best if you’re on a low-fat or low-sodium diet.
